The Power Chord King wrote:
I must be darn impressionable. At my local guitar supplier, I was playing a Gibson SG look alike. Had the body of the SG but the shape of a Strat. I was playing it then I asked my friend (and manager) buddy when he was gonna get a real SG. He said never. I said why. His response: "We don't like to rip people off." I am still trying to understand what he meant by that. I mean they are expensive, but are they really that bad. Any SG owners out there?


He's talking about value for the dollar. I'm fairly sure the real reason he doesn't carry Gibson's is because he can't afford to. When you enter into a sales agreement with the major manufacturers you have to agree to move so many units per quarter. That means he has to shell out for X amount of guitars whether he can afford it then or not. A lot of smaller shops just can't afford to carry that much over head.
